The BCCI has announced women’s team for the upcoming ICC Women’s World Cup Qualifier. Mithali Raj will lead the 14-member squad in the tournament that will take place in Colombo from February 3.

The Indian selectors have not made any changes in the squad that whitewashed West Indies in November. Only Mona Meshram has failed to make the cut in the Mithali-led squad.

“I am actually happy that there are no changes. We are coming from a very successful one-day series,” Mithali said. “It means that the girls, whoever got the opportunity, have done well in three games.”

“I don’t think there is any chance to change or get in any new faces, especially for qualifiers which is so important.”

India missed the direct qualification by a whisker. They, however, are the top contenders among the ten teams to reach the main round in England. A recent series win over the Windies will also boost their confidence.

ICC Women’s World Cup Qualifier Team: Mithali Raj (c), Harmanpreet Kaur, Smriti Mandhana, MD Thirush Kamini, Veda Krishnamurthy, Devika Vaidya, Sushma Verma (wk), Jhulan Goswami, Shikha Pandey, Sukanya Parida, Poonam Yadav, Ekta Bisht, Rajeshwari Gayakwad and Deepti Sharma
